 8/13- Belfast ME

   The weather played a big role in today’s plans. There was no wind scheduled to blow until later in the afternoon. There were thunderstorms predicted to hit Belfast later in the afternoon. This combination of events led us to quickly scamper out of Brooksville and motor across the bay. It was truly flat calm and we had the tide with us so we made Belfast by 1:00pm. 

   This is an odd harbor as there is a great deal of current in the river and when the wind opposes the tide weird things happen. As the wind picked up a bit this afternoon the waves built quickly. The boat must have circled the  mooring ball 3 or 4 times twisting and turning as the current battled the wind. 

   We all got together for a nice meal in town before heading to the park for some music. The thunderstorm missed us but went on to ravage several towns further south. When the skies cleared and the retreating clouds were lit by the sun it was surreal.
